Web11 apr. 2024 · Death penalty not proven as best preventive measure — Deputy minister. KUALA LUMPUR, April 11 — The Abolition of Mandatory Death Penalty Bill 2024 would not necessarily lead to an increase in serious crime cases, the Dewan Negara was told today.
